Bridging Real-World Modelling and Secondary Mathematics Education

This project explores how authentic modelling approaches (for example Bayesian reasoning and systems thinking) can be integrated into secondary mathematics classrooms to enhance engagement and conceptual understanding.

Modelling student engagement and success using Bayesian networks

This PhD project investigates how academic, wellbeing, family, and school-context factors interact to shape student engagement, retention, and academic success in secondary schooling.
